Local Recycling Centers and Municipal Programs

Many cities and municipalities offer specialized recycling programs for air conditioning units, recognizing the need to handle these appliances responsibly due to their refrigerants and metals. Local recycling centers are often equipped to safely dismantle AC units, recover valuable components, and properly dispose of hazardous materials.

When seeking a local recycling center, it is important to verify whether the facility accepts air conditioning units specifically, as not all centers handle electronic or HVAC waste. Municipal programs may provide scheduled collection days or drop-off locations for bulky appliances, including AC units.

Key considerations when using local recycling programs include:

  • Confirming accepted items to avoid rejected drop-offs
  • Understanding any fees associated with recycling
  • Checking if prior appointment or registration is required
  • Ensuring refrigerant recovery is performed by certified technicians

Many municipal programs also collaborate with licensed HVAC contractors to facilitate the removal and safe disposal of refrigerants, which are regulated due to environmental impacts.

Retailer and Manufacturer Take-Back Programs

Several retailers and manufacturers have established take-back or trade-in programs to encourage responsible recycling of air conditioning units. These programs often provide convenient options for consumers replacing old units with new ones and may even offer incentives or discounts.

Take-back programs typically involve:

  • Returning the old AC unit to the retailer at the point of purchase
  • Scheduling a pickup service through the manufacturer or retailer
  • Participating in mail-back programs for smaller components or parts

Retailers engaged in these programs usually partner with certified recycling vendors who specialize in refrigerant extraction and metal reclamation.

Benefits of using retailer or manufacturer programs include:

  • Convenience and streamlined disposal process
  • Compliance with environmental regulations ensured by partners
  • Potential financial incentives or rebates

It is advisable to inquire directly with the retailer or manufacturer regarding eligibility, program availability, and any associated costs.

Professional HVAC Recycling Services

Professional HVAC recycling services specialize in the dismantling, refrigerant recovery, and recycling of air conditioning units. These companies often work with commercial and residential customers, offering comprehensive solutions that comply with all relevant environmental laws.

Advantages of using professional recycling services include:

  • Expert handling of refrigerants in accordance with EPA or local environmental agency standards
  • Safe disposal or recycling of metals, plastics, and electronic components
  • Proper documentation and certification of recycling for regulatory compliance

Such services may offer:

  • On-site pickup and removal
  • Scheduled bulk collection for multiple units
  • Customized recycling plans for businesses or institutions

When selecting a professional service, confirm their licensing, certifications, and reputation to ensure responsible recycling practices.

Regulatory Considerations and Environmental Impact

Air conditioning units contain refrigerants such as hydrochlorofluorocarbons (HCFCs) or hydrofluorocarbons (HFCs) that have significant environmental impacts if released. Proper recycling is mandated under laws such as the Clean Air Act in the United States, which requires certified recovery of these substances.

Environmental considerations include:

  • Preventing Ozone Depletion: Certain refrigerants contribute to ozone layer damage if improperly vented.
  • Reducing Greenhouse Gas Emissions: Many refrigerants are potent greenhouse gases.
  • Resource Conservation: Recycling metals and plastics reduces the need for virgin materials.

Compliance with regulations is not only a legal obligation but also a critical step in minimizing ecological harm. Always ensure the chosen recycling method aligns with local and national environmental laws.

Options for Recycling Air Conditioning Units

Recycling air conditioning (AC) units is essential for environmental safety, as these appliances contain refrigerants and metals that require proper handling. Below are the primary avenues for recycling AC units safely and effectively:

Many components of AC units, including copper coils, aluminum fins, steel frames, and refrigerants, can be recovered and reused. However, handling these materials demands adherence to environmental regulations, especially for refrigerants, which must be reclaimed or destroyed by certified technicians.

  • Local Recycling Centers: Most municipal recycling facilities accept metal components from AC units but may not handle refrigerants. Contacting local centers to confirm accepted materials and any preparation requirements is advised.
  • Appliance Retailers and HVAC Dealers: Some retailers and HVAC companies offer recycling or trade-in programs for old units when purchasing new equipment.
  • Certified HVAC Technicians: Professionals certified under EPA Section 608 are qualified to recover refrigerants safely and can facilitate responsible disposal of refrigerant-containing components.
  • Scrap Metal Yards: Many scrap yards accept the metal parts of AC units; however, refrigerants must be removed beforehand by a certified technician.
  • Municipal Hazardous Waste Programs: These programs often organize periodic collection events for appliances containing refrigerants and other hazardous materials.

Key Considerations When Recycling AC Units

Proper recycling of AC units involves several critical steps to ensure safety and regulatory compliance. These considerations help prevent environmental contamination and maximize material recovery:

Consideration Description Recommended Action
Refrigerant Recovery AC units contain refrigerants that are harmful to the ozone layer and must be carefully extracted. Hire EPA-certified HVAC technicians to recover refrigerants before recycling.
Disassembly Separating metals, plastics, and electronic components improves recycling efficiency. Disassemble units according to facility guidelines or let professionals handle this step.
Documentation Some jurisdictions require proof of proper refrigerant handling and disposal. Request certificates or receipts from recycling or service providers.
Local Regulations Recycling requirements vary by location and may involve special permits or programs. Consult local environmental agencies or waste management authorities for compliance.

Finding Recycling Locations Near You

Locating an appropriate recycling facility or service for AC units can be streamlined by using specialized tools and resources:

  • EPA’s Responsible Appliance Disposal (RAD) Program: Provides resources and listings for certified appliance recyclers.
  • Earth911 Recycling Search: An online database where users can input their zip code and item type to find nearby recycling centers.
  • Local Government Websites: Often maintain directories of approved hazardous waste and appliance recycling sites.
  • HVAC Contractors: Many provide recycling services or can refer customers to reliable recyclers.
  • Retail Take-Back Programs: Some major appliance retailers offer take-back or recycling services when delivering new units.

Preparing Your AC Unit for Recycling

Before dropping off or scheduling pickup for an AC unit, preparing it properly can facilitate recycling and ensure safety:

  • Ensure Refrigerant Removal: Confirm that a certified technician has recovered all refrigerant gases.
  • Drain Fluids: Remove any residual oils or water that may be present in the unit.
  • Remove Personal Items: Clear any accessories or attachments that are not part of the AC unit itself.
  • Check for Hazardous Components: Identify and segregate batteries or electronic control boards for specialized recycling.
  • Label the Unit: If required by the recycler, tag the unit indicating refrigerant removal and any disassembly performed.

Frequently Asked Questions (FAQs)

Where can I recycle old air conditioning units?
You can recycle old AC units at local recycling centers, scrap metal yards, or specialized appliance recycling facilities. Many municipalities also offer scheduled bulk waste pickup services that accept AC units.

Are there specific facilities that handle refrigerants in AC units?
Yes, certified recycling centers and HVAC service providers are equipped to safely recover and dispose of refrigerants in compliance with environmental regulations.

Do I need to remove any parts before recycling my AC unit?
It is recommended to have a professional remove refrigerants and hazardous components. Other parts like metal casings and copper coils can usually be recycled as is.

Is there a cost associated with recycling air conditioning units?
Costs vary by location and facility. Some centers accept AC units for free, while others may charge a small fee to cover refrigerant recovery and processing.

Can I donate a working air conditioning unit instead of recycling it?
Yes, if the unit is functional, consider donating it to charities, shelters, or community organizations that accept used appliances.

How do I find the nearest recycling center for AC units?
Use online resources such as Earth911 or contact your local waste management authority to locate nearby facilities that accept air conditioning units for recycling.
